POSITION SUMMARY The Assistant Athletic Trainer will be a highly qualified individual that possesses a strong understanding of the Universitys mission, excellent attention to detail, strong work ethic, and ability to multitask. The Assistant Athletic Trainer will be qualified to provide comprehensive sports medicine care for Franciscan student athletes across every sport.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ES Provide comprehensive sports medicine care for the student athletes in 19 varsity sports. Handle emergencies, know the Emergency Action Plans (EAPs) and apply them accurately and efficiently. Competently provide first aid to student athletes. Document the care of the student athlete by utilizing online software and paperwork. Oversee the Athletic Training Room as assigned by the Athletic Trainer. Assist the Athletic Trainers with coverage of athletic events as assigned. Complete injury assessments, treatments, and rehabilitation for student athletes. Perform other duties as assigned by the Athletic Trainers and Administration.

REQUIREMENTS
Must understand, support, and embrace the mission of Franciscan University of Steubenville and possess the following:

Education and Experience
• Bachelors or Masters degree in Athletic Training
• Preferred one year of experience or high academic achievement
Technical Skills
• Understanding of software and database management
• Injury evaluation; injury prevention skills
• Implement Rehabilitation and Treatment programs
• Various techniques including manual therapy, therapeutic exercises, and modalities
• Has knowledge of various therapeutic modalities utilized for pre- and post-treatments
• Has knowledge of various athletic taping techniques and is able to differentiate appropriate use

Non-Technical Skills & Competencies:
• Communication and interpersonal skills in order to work effectively with athletes and coaches
• Empathy and compassion; understanding the physical and emotional challenges of athletes
• Attention to detail; needs to be meticulous in documentation of treatment
• Time management: effectively manage multitasks and priorities in a highly busy environment
• Problem solving to assist student athletes with medical needs

Certifications & Licenses:
• Must be certified by the National Athletic Trainers Association Board of Certification (NATABOC)
• CPR/AED certification
• Must hold or be eligible for Ohio State Licensure

Workplace Factors:
• Will have some travel requirements with teams as assigned by the Athletic Trainer(s)
• Must be available to work various shifts, including night and weekend coverage, as assigned by the Athletic Trainer(s)
• Must be able to perform in a demanding, fast-moving environment.
